Summary of Internet Poker:
Online poker, also called internet poker, is the digital version for the conventional card game played in gambling enterprises and poker rooms. It allows players to take part in real time poker games via desktop computer computers, smart phones, also digital devices. With the aid of safe online connections and higher level pc software, players can participate in multiplayer games, compete keenly against opponents from about society, and test their skills whenever, anywhere.

Drawbacks of Online Poker:
While internet poker offers several advantages, it isn't without its downsides. The absence of face to face relationship gets rid of the opportunity to read opponents' body gestures and facial expressions, which are important components of conventional poker. Furthermore, the current presence of digital systems and privacy can result in increased dangers of fraud, collusion, and hacking, necessitating rigid laws and protected methods to protect people' passions. Lastly, the ease of internet based play might play a role in addicting gambling habits, requiring accountable gambling initiatives and adequate player assistance components.
